Which structures are responsible for producing semen

Respuesta :

Rofeeah Rofeeah
  • 25-04-2017
The structures that are responsible for producing semen are within the make reproductive system. these include the testes, epidymus, prostate, seminal vesicles, and the bulbourethral gland.
